Lone Chimney, OK and Pumpkin Hollow, OK have a very similar cost of living, with only a 4.3% difference in their overall index. Lone Chimney scores 82 while Pumpkin Hollow scores 86 on the cost of living index, where 100 represents the national average. The day-to-day expenses for residents in both cities are comparable, though differences emerge when looking at specific categories.

When it comes to buying, median home values in Lone Chimney are $133,900 compared to $179,500 in Pumpkin Hollow, a 25% gap.

Median household income in Lone Chimney is $21,635 compared to $79,432 in Pumpkin Hollow (-72.8%). While Pumpkin Hollow is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income.
